A bit of sunshine from last weekend. We put up the hammock between the trees in the garden as I have seen how well Little man L is stimulated by anything that swings. A lot of SID kids enjoy swinging and it calms them. It proved to be a huge hit with all 3 the kids who had so much fun on it.


Later on they brought out their camping chairs and had fun "camping out" in the garden. When Hunter loaded the bakkie (Ute) to take away the garden refuse they all climbed in and were imagining seeing rhinos and cheetahs in the game reserve. I love it that my kids are growing up sharing this love of ours - nature and the outdoors, be it just in our own garden.
